Finance Review Summary — Insurance Renewal

The renewal of Marlow & Pitt coverage for the Greystone facility was completed within budget, with premiums up 4% year on year. Deductibles remain unchanged, and the liability ceiling was raised at no extra cost. No claims were filed during the term. The note below outlines related plans for the coming cycle.

confidential, kagap-kajeg: Istethax Holdings is in early talks to buy Ulaielix Works for about $23.7 million. The Lamys launch date is July 6, and nothing goes to the press before then.

### Capacity note: spoolerd

Heads-up for the review: the Quillfeather print spooler holds jobs in memory before flushing to the queue, so the caps below matter for both capacity and blast radius. We sized them off peak traffic from the Harwick office rollout, plus ~30% headroom. Everything enforcing those caps lives in one config block, reproduced here.

constants for bagaf-hadup:
QUOTAS = {
    "quenael": 1,
    "ralwyn": 1,
    "oliath": 2,
    "ulaael": 2,
}

**Mgmt Meeting Minutes — Retiring the Brightline Range**

Quick recap for sales leads at Fenholt Supplies: we agreed to retire the Brightline fixture range by year-end. Remaining stock moves to clearance pricing next month, and accounts on standing orders get migrated to the Lumetta range. Trade-in incentives were approved in principle. The confidential note on next steps sits just below.

board note of bajof-bajeg: The pricing group signed off on a budget of $13.4 million for Project Sildor. The renewal with Lamixek Holdings closes at $48.9 million a year, 49 percent above the last contract.